Effects of intermittent cycles of ischemia with resistance and endurance training on Murf-1 and Atrogin-1 gene expression and fiber diameter of gastrocnemius muscle in diabetic rats
Background and Purpose: Muscular atrophy is one of the most common complications of diabetes. Exercise training has been suggested as one of the treatment strategies for muscular atrophy in diabetes.
